Kebbi Governor commissions Livestock market in Jega

Kebbi Governor commissions Livestock market in Jega

 

By Auwal Ilyasu

 

Kebbi State Governor, Atiku Bagudu on Friday commissioned the new Livestock market in the Jega Local Government Area (LGA) of the state.

According to the Governor, who described the day as historic, the commissioning of the market was to ensure that, it takes off properly before the forthcoming Eid-El-Kabir celebrations.

 

This was contained in a statement that was issued by Yahaya Sarki, Special Adviser (SA) Media to the Governor.

 

He said that the governor called on the people of the state to ensure the prevalence of peace, unity, and cooperation.

 

Stated that Bagudu who is the Chairman of the APC Governors’ Forum added that, he was optimistic that, the market would contribute to the socio-economic development of the area, the state, and Nigeria in general.

 

“He also said, I am certain that, In Sha Allah, the new Kara Market will be a renowned local and international livestock market and I am hoping that, it will be bustling with activities.

 

“We are also hoping that it will one day transform into a robust meat and dairy products industry for both local consumption and exports,” Sarki stated.

 

Sarki said the Governor noted that Jega as the economic nerve center of Kebbi State deserves more of such investments, just as he acknowledged the support of all the critical stakeholders.

 

“He added saying, Bagudu noted that, Jega is abundantly blessed with a myriad of renowned successful businessmen, whose wealth of experience will bring to bear on the new market”.

 

Also, Governor Bagudu disclosed that the State government has secured about N1.7 billion loan to boost livestock production and dairy produce development.

 

He promised that similar markets would be established in Argungu, Suru, Gwandu, Samanaji, Dodoru, Ribah, and Dadin Kowa communities of the State.

 

According to the statement by Sarki, the Chairman of Jega LGA, Shehu Marshall had in his remarks, expressed his happiness over the commissioning of the new ultramodern market.

 

“He said that the Ultramodern livestock market comprised six sections, a police unit for providing security, a mosque, and toilets,” Sarki stated.

 

The SA added that “Mashal extolled the laudable projects carried out by Senator Abubakar Atiku Bagudu since he assumed office in 2015”.

 

“I must commend Governor Bagudu for the construction and commissioning of this modern livestock market in Jega the commercial nerve center of the state”.

 

“On his part, the Sarkin Kabin Jega Alhaji Arzika Bawa Jega described the project as invaluable to the people of Jega.

 

He praised Governor Bagudu for carrying out numerous developmental projects despite the dwindling economy of the state,” Sarki said.
